Billionaire investor Bill Ackman has ignited a viral buzz with some unconventional dating tips he recently shared online.

Ackman, the 58-year-old mastermind behind Pershing Square Capital Management with a fortune estimated at $9.3 billion, dispensed what he described as “old-school wisdom” aimed at young men who find it difficult to connect with women face-to-face.

In a post on X, Ackman expressed his concern over a cultural shift that seemingly leaves young men feeling isolated and hesitant to initiate offline interactions with women.

“With that in mind, I wanted to offer a few words from my younger days that helped me approach someone I found intriguing,” he shared.

His suggestion was straightforward: “May I meet you?” This phrase, he noted, would precede any further conversation.

Ackman also emphasized that his approach, grounded in “proper grammar and politeness,” was surprisingly effective, claiming it “almost never got a No.”

He added, “Just two cents from an older happily married guy concerned about our next generation’s happiness and population replacement rates.”

While Ackman may have intended his words as mentorship, the internet quickly made them a laughing stock.

Thousands of users across X transformed “May I meet you?” into a meme, pairing the phrase with images of awkward party encounters and uncomfortable exchanges between men and women.

One viral post featured comedian Shane Gillis staring creepily into the camera, while another showed a man awkwardly gazing at a group of women at a party.

One user joked, “May I meet you first thing Monday morning to talk about your performance improvement plan?” above a photo of a smiling woman, which was a playful jab at the line’s stilted formality.

Known for his outspoken commentary, he has become a prominent MAGA donor and an influential voice in conservative circles.

His firm, Pershing Square, which manages roughly $16 billion in assets, is one of Wall Street’s most closely watched hedge funds, with Ackman famous for high-profile bets on companies like Chipotle and Herbalife.

Ackman married designer Neri Oxman in 2019 after divorcing his first wife, landscape architect Karen Herskovitz, with whom he shares three daughters.
